Which resins are used for printing inks?
The right resin depends on the printing process, solvent system, substrate and required film properties. Our printing-ink portfolio includes polyamide, polyurethane, ketonic, rosin-modified maleic, phenolic and PVB resins for flexographic, gravure, offset, screen and other ink formulations.

Which resins are used in paints and industrial coatings?
Our coatings portfolio includes alkyd, ketonic, rosin-modified maleic, phenolic and other specialty resin systems for applications such as decorative paints, primers, enamels, lacquers, wood finishes and industrial coatings. The appropriate resin depends on requirements such as drying behaviour, hardness, flexibility, gloss, compatibility and application method.

What curing agents do you offer for epoxy systems?
Our epoxy curing-agent range includes phenalkamines, liquid polyamide epoxy hardeners and cycloaliphatic polyamine adducts. Different grades are available for applications including protective and marine coatings, adhesives, flooring, casting, potting and other epoxy systems.

How do I choose the right resin grade for my formulation?
Start with the application, resin chemistry and performance requirements of the formulation. Factors such as solvent compatibility, viscosity, solids, adhesion, drying behaviour, flexibility, substrate and end-use conditions can all influence grade selection.
